Crispy Southwest Chicken Burritos

Author: foodyschmoody

Ingredients

  • 1 T olive oil
  • 1 onion diced
  • 1 lb ground chicken
  • 2 T Southwest Seasoning
  • 1 can black beans rinsed and drained
  • 1 can corn drained
  • 2 C brown rice prepared
  • 1 C shredded cheese Mexican blend
  • 6 large burrito size flour tortillas

Instructions

  • Heat oil in a large saute pan, over medium/high heat. Add onion and ground chicken. Cook until chicken is cooked through and onion is soft.
  • Drain if necessary and return to pan.
  • Stir seasoning into chicken & onion and turn heat to medium.
  • Add beans, rice and corn. Cook until warmed through, about 4 minutes.
  • Lay a tortilla flat and place about ΒΌ C of filling into the bottom 3rd of tortilla (leaving an edge). Sprinkle cheese over filling. Fold up and over the filling and then fold in the sides before continuing to roll the rest up into a burrito. Place seam side down and continue to roll the rest.
  • In a large saute pan, heat 1 teaspoon oil over medium/high heat. Add burritos, 2 at a time and cook about 2 minutes per side.

If baking is preferred:

  • Place burritos seam side down, on a wire rack placed on top of a baking sheet. Spray burritos with a spray of cooking spray or oil and bake 12 minutes at 400.
